Cats are great because they can snuggle, but have enough indepances to styay home during he day. If you go on vacation, nearly any friend can take care of a cat without killing it. Moreover, cats are small enough to go on car, boat, or plane trips with you.

I don't dislike any domestic animal. But, I'm a dog guy. I appreciate that a dog is pretty much the only animal you can realistically incorporate into your life outside of being at home. Dogs can come camping and hiking, they can comfortably travel with you if you have the right accommodations. And most dogs really, really enjoy this kind of stuff.

I have cat allergies. Not serious, but enough that it can be annoying to be around cats if I forget to take my allergy medicine. That said, I've met a couple of extremely cool cats over the last couple years, so I could really see the appeal if you get the animal with the right temperament for you.
